  • Problem with Light Cache - HashMap

    I was getting a light circle above the spotlights with a white (190 white) material until I switch to the old KD tree light cache or change the material to a darker one.
    I used reset x-form on the spotlights and even put a cup-like object into the spots, to be sure there is a closed object inside of the spots, but nothing worked except switching to the KD tree.

    What is going wrong?
